The Impact
India's stock market just took a brutal hit. The Nifty 50 suffered its biggest single-day drop in 12 months, erasing a staggering ₹13 lakh crore in market capitalization. Ten Nifty constituents now hover at 52-week lows, with the index testing levels last seen during the COVID crash of March 2020.
